Ahmed Abdullahi Transfer from Sunderland to Eyüpspor
Turkish side Eyüpspor are reportedly the primary contender to sign Sunderland's Nigerian striker, Ahmed Abdullahi, as Sunderland is seeking to transfer the 22-year-old after a period affected by injuries since his arrival from Belgian side Gent in August 2024. A deal for Abdullahi is nearing completion. It is said that talks are ongoing, although it is not yet clear whether the transfer would be a loan or a permanent move, or what the potential fee might be. His contract at Sunderland is due to expire in June 2028. Abdullahi has been capped for Nigeria at U20 level, scoring two goals in seven appearances, and has a current market value of €800k according to Transfermarkt.
